Output 83ac768213646a5002533ad3c31fa975b80b8bc059a8f96b4633d1b2e021c247:0

value
369734
script pubkey
OP_0 OP_PUSHBYTES_20 3bd2f061d70d96c79bde507017dbcf6fcd03f3ec
address
bc1q80f0qcwhpktv0x772pcp0k70dlxs8ulvsnp55u
transaction
83ac768213646a5002533ad3c31fa975b80b8bc059a8f96b4633d1b2e021c247
spent
true